Being the biggest city on Panay Island and the center of Western Visayas region, Iloilo City is a transportation hub whether by land, sea or air. These numerous transportation terminals facilitate day to day commerce, light & heavy industries, and tourism, among others. As this is a travel blog, this guide is aimed to tourists who want to experience and explore Iloilo and perhaps even beyond. Iloilo International Airport A little more than five years old, the Iloilo International Airpor t is among the most modern and beautiful in the country today. It is situated around 20 kilometers from Iloilo City , straddling the towns of Cabatuan, San Miguel and Sta. Barbara . It has direct links to Manila, Cebu, Clark, Cebu, Davao, Cagayan de Oro  and Puerto Princesa plus international destinations Hong Kong and Singapore . St. Joseph Chapel at Festive Walk Iloilo's The Deck

While most malls around the country host Sunday masses in some obscure hallway filled with plastic chairs with a makeshift altar, some malls have built niches or transformed unused spaces into places of worship. And Ilonggos should be proud that one of the newest malls in Iloilo City has actually a chapel located in a prime spot and one that boasts both beauty and serenity.  The St. Joseph Chapel at Festive Walk Iloilo is located in one of its al fresco areas known as The Deck located  at the 3rd level. While this open air area also has a mini plaza and dog park (and soon - cafes and restaurants) it is the chapel that highlights this al fresco part of the mall. Eucharistic mass services are held every Sunday at 11am while first Friday masses at 5pm.  It is open to the public everyday for personal moments of silence and solitude.
